---
'@backstage/plugin-auth-backend': minor
---
CookieConfigurer can optionally return the `SameSite` cookie attribute.
CookieConfigurer now requires an additional argument `appOrigin` - the origin URL of the app - which is used to calculate the `SameSite` attribute.
defaultCookieConfigurer returns the `SameSite` attribute which defaults to `Lax`. In cases where an auth-backend is running on a different domain than the App, `SameSite=None` is used - but only for secure contexts. This is so that cookies can be included in third-party requests.
OAuthAdapterOptions has been modified to require additional arguments, `baseUrl`, and `cookieConfigurer`.
OAuthAdapter now resolves cookie configuration using its supplied CookieConfigurer for each request to make sure that the proper attributes always are set.

---
'@backstage/cli': minor
---
**BREAKING**: Bumped `jest`, `jest-runtime`, and `jest-environment-jsdom` to v29. This is up from v27, so check out both the [v28](https://jestjs.io/docs/28.x/upgrading-to-jest28) and [v29](https://jestjs.io/docs/upgrading-to-jest29) (later [here](https://jestjs.io/docs/29.x/upgrading-to-jest29)) migration guides.
Particular changes that where encountered in the main Backstage repo are:
- The updated snapshot format.
- `jest.useFakeTimers('legacy')` is now `jest.useFakeTimers({ legacyFakeTimers: true })`.
- Error objects collected by `withLogCollector` from `@backstage/test-utils` are now objects with a `detail` property rather than a string.

---
'@backstage/cli': patch
---
Removed `tsx` and `jsx` as supported extensions in backend packages. For most
repos, this will not have any effect. But if you inadvertently had added some
`tsx`/`jsx` files to your backend package, you may now start to see `code: 'MODULE_NOT_FOUND'` errors when launching the backend locally. The reason for
this is that the offending files get ignored during transpilation. Hence, the
importing file can no longer find anything to import.
The fix is to rename any `.tsx` files in your backend packages to `.ts` instead,
or `.jsx` to `.js`.

# Enabling SSL for Local Testing
If you need to use an `https:` URL for local testing (i.e. if an OAuth provider requires a "secure" callback URL), you can use a self-signed certificate by following these steps.
## Backend
1. Generate a self-signed certificate and key for localhost and configure your system to trust it. The application [`mkcert`](https://github.com/FiloSottile/mkcert) is a helpful tool to accomplish this.
1. Update `backend.baseUrl` in app-config.local.yaml to use an `https:` address.
1. Add the certificate and key to `backend.https.certificate.cert` and `backend.https.certificate.cert`, respectively.
```yaml
backend:
baseUrl: https://localhost:7007
https:
certificate:
# You may copy the contents of the file...
cert: |
-----BEGIN CERTIFICATE-----
MIIDCTCCAfGgAwIBAgIUZ9VhZckcy690L
...
-----END CERTIFICATE-----
# ... or use a path
key:
$file: ./certs/localhost-key.pem
```
1. Start the backend with `NODE_EXTRA_CA_CERTS=/absolute/path/to/cert.pem yarn start-backend`
## Frontend
1. As with the backend instructions above, a trusted certificate and key are needed.
1. Update `app.baseUrl` and `backend.cors.origin` in app-config.local.yaml to use an `https:` address.
1. Add the certificate and key to `app.https.certificate.cert` and `app.https.certificate.cert`, respectively.
```yaml
app:
baseUrl: https://localhost:3000
https:
certificate:
cert:
$file: ./certs/localhost.pem
key:
$file: ./certs/localhost-key.pem
backend:
cors:
origin: https://localhost:3000
```
1. and start the app with `yarn start`.
Depending on what plugins are in use, you may need to override additional URLs to use `https` for those endpoints to work.

### Azure
The Azure server side authentication provider works by authenticating on the server with
the Azure CLI, please note that [Azure AD Authentication][1] is a requirement and has to
be enabled in your AKS cluster, then follow these steps:
- [Install the Azure CLI][2] in the environment where the backstage application will run.
- Login with your Azure/Microsoft account with `az login` in the server's terminal.
- Go to your AKS cluster's resource page in Azure Console and follow the steps in the
`Connect` tab to set the subscription and get your credentials for `kubectl` integration.
- Configure your cluster to use the `azure` auth provider like this:
```yaml
kubernetes:
clusterLocatorMethods:
- type: 'config'
clusters:
- name: My AKS cluster
url: ${AZURE_CLUSTER_API_SERVER_ADDRESS}
authProvider: azure
skipTLSVerify: true
```
To get the API server address for your Azure cluster, go to the Azure console page for the
cluster resource, go to `Overview` > `Properties` tab > `Networking` section and copy paste
the API server address directly in that `url` field.

---
id: writing-custom-step-layouts
title: Writing custom step layouts
description: How to override the default step form layout
---
Every form in each step rendered in the frontend uses the default form layout from [react-json-schema-form](https://react-jsonschema-form.readthedocs.io/). It is possible to override this behaviour by supplying a `ui:ObjectFieldTemplate` property for a particular step:
```yaml
parameters:
- title: Fill in some steps
ui:ObjectFieldTemplate: TwoColumn
```
This is the same [field](https://react-jsonschema-form.readthedocs.io/en/latest/advanced-customization/custom-templates/#objectfieldtemplate) used by [react-json-schema-form](https://react-jsonschema-form.readthedocs.io/) but we need to add a couple of steps to ensure that the string value of `TwoColumn` above is resolved to a react component.
## Registering a React component as a custom step layout
The [createScaffolderLayout](https://backstage.io/docs/reference/plugin-scaffolder.createscaffolderlayout) function is used to mark a component as a custom step layout:
```ts
import React from 'react';
import {
createScaffolderLayout,
LayoutTemplate,
scaffolderPlugin,
} from '@backstage/plugin-scaffolder';
import { Grid } from '@material-ui/core';
const TwoColumn: LayoutTemplate = ({ properties, description, title }) => {
const mid = Math.ceil(properties.length / 2);
return (
<>
<h1>{title}</h1>
<h2>In two column layout!!</h2>
<Grid container justifyContent="flex-end">
{properties.slice(0, mid).map(prop => (
<Grid item xs={6} key={prop.content.key}>
{prop.content}
</Grid>
))}
{properties.slice(mid).map(prop => (
<Grid item xs={6} key={prop.content.key}>
{prop.content}
</Grid>
))}
</Grid>
{description}
</>
);
};
export const TwoColumnLayout = scaffolderPlugin.provide(
createScaffolderLayout({
name: 'TwoColumn',
component: TwoColumn,
}),
);
```
After you have registered your component as a custom layout then you need to provide the `layouts` to the `ScaffolderPage`:
```tsx
import { MyCustomFieldExtension } from './scaffolder/MyCustomExtension';
import { TwoColumnLayout } from './components/scaffolder/customScaffolderLayouts';
const routes = (
<FlatRoutes>
...
<Route path="/create" element={<ScaffolderPage />}>
<ScaffolderLayouts>
<TwoColumnLayout />
</ScaffolderLayouts>
</Route>
...
</FlatRoutes>
);
```
## Using the custom step layout
Any component that has been passed to the `ScaffolderPage` as children of the `ScaffolderLayouts` component can be used as a `ui:ObjectFieldTemplate` in your template file:
```yaml
parameters:
- title: Fill in some steps
ui:ObjectFieldTemplate: TwoColumn
```

---
id: 05-frontend-authorization
title: 5. Frontend Components with Authorization
description: Placing frontend components behind authorization
---
In the previous sections, we learned how to protect our plugin's backend API routes with the permission framework. Most routes that return some data to be displayed (such as our `GET /todos` route) need no additional changes on the frontend, as the backend will simply return an empty list or a `404`. However, for UI elements that trigger a mutative action, it's common practice to hide or disable them when a user doesn't have permission.
Take, for example, the "Add" button in our todo list application. When a user clicks this button, the frontend makes a `POST` request to the `/todos` route of our backend. If a user tries to add a todo but is not authorized, they will have no way of knowing this until they perform the action and are faced with an error. This is a poor user experience. We can do better by disabling the add button.
> Note: Placing frontend components behind authorization cannot take the place of placing your backend routes behind authorization. Authorization checks on the frontend should be used in _addition_ to the corresponding backend authorization, as an improvement to the user experience. If you do not place your backend route behind authorization, a malicious actor can still send a request to the route even if you disabled the corresponding frontend component.
## Using `usePermission`
Let's start by adding the packages we will need:
```
$ yarn workspace @internal/plugin-todo-list \
add @backstage/plugin-permission-react @internal/plugin-todo-list-common
```
Let's make the following changes in `plugins/todo-list/src/components/TodoListPage/TodoListPage.tsx`:
```diff
...
import {
alertApiRef,
discoveryApiRef,
fetchApiRef,
useApi,
} from '@backstage/core-plugin-api';
+ import { usePermission } from '@backstage/plugin-permission-react';
+ import { todoListCreatePermission } from '@internal/plugin-todo-list-common';
...
function AddTodo({ onAdd }: { onAdd: (title: string) => any }) {
const title = useRef('');
+ const { loading: loadingPermission, allowed: canAddTodo } = usePermission({ permission: todoListCreatePermission });
return (
<>
<Typography variant="body1">Add todo</Typography>
<Box
component="span"
alignItems="flex-end"
display="flex"
flexDirection="row"
>
<TextField
placeholder="Write something here..."
onChange={e => (title.current = e.target.value)}
/>
- <Button variant="contained" onClick={handleAdd}>
- Add
- </Button>
+ {!loadingPermission && (
+ <Button disabled={!canAddTodo} variant="contained" onClick={handleAdd}>
+ Add
+ </Button>
+ )}
</Box>
</>
);
}
...
```
Here we are using the [`usePermission` hook](https://backstage.io/docs/reference/plugin-permission-react.usepermission) to communicate with the permission policy and receive a decision on whether this user is authorized to create a todo list item.
It's really that simple! Let's change our policy to test the disabled button:
```diff
// packages/backend/src/plugins/permission.ts
...
if (isPermission(request.permission, todoListCreatePermission)) {
return {
- result: AuthorizeResult.ALLOW,
+ result: AuthorizeResult.DENY,
};
}
...
```
And now you should see that you are not able to create a todo item from the frontend!
## Using `RequirePermission`
Providing a disabled state can be a helpful signal to users, but there may be cases where hiding the element is preferred. For such cases, you can use the provided [`RequirePermission` component](https://backstage.io/docs/reference/plugin-permission-react.requirepermission):
```diff
// plugins/todo-list/src/components/TodoListPage/TodoListPage.tsx
...
import {
alertApiRef,
discoveryApiRef,
fetchApiRef,
useApi,
} from '@backstage/core-plugin-api';
- import { usePermission } from '@backstage/plugin-permission-react';
+ import { RequirePermission } from '@backstage/plugin-permission-react';
import { todoListCreatePermission } from '@internal/plugin-todo-list-common';
...
export const TodoListPage = () => {
...
<Grid container spacing={3} direction="column">
- <Grid item>
- <AddTodo onAdd={handleAdd} />
- </Grid>
+ <RequirePermission permission={todoListCreatePermission}>
+ <Grid item>
+ <AddTodo onAdd={handleAdd} />
+ </Grid>
+ </RequirePermission>
<Grid item>
<TodoList key={key} onEdit={setEdit} />
</Grid>
</Grid>
...
function AddTodo({ onAdd }: { onAdd: (title: string) => any }) {
const title = useRef('');
- const { loading: loadingPermission, allowed: canAddTodo } = usePermission({ permission: todoListCreatePermission });
return (
<>
<Typography variant="body1">Add todo</Typography>
<Box
component="span"
alignItems="flex-end"
display="flex"
flexDirection="row"
>
<TextField
placeholder="Write something here..."
onChange={e => (title.current = e.target.value)}
/>
- {!loadingPermission && (
- <Button disabled={!canAddTodo} variant="contained" onClick={handleAdd}>
- Add
- </Button>
- )}
+ <Button variant="contained" onClick={handleAdd}>
+ Add
+ </Button>
</Box>
</>
);
}
...
```
Now you should find that the component for adding a todo list item does not render at all. Success!

---
id: v1.6.0
title: v1.6.0
description: Backstage Release v1.6.0
---
These are the release notes for the v1.6.0 release of [Backstage](https://backstage.io/).
A huge thanks to the whole team of maintainers and contributors as well as the amazing Backstage Community for the hard work in getting this release developed and done.
## Highlights
### Moved to `swc` for transpilation
Weve replaced `sucrase` with [`swc`](https://swc.rs/) for transpilation in the Backstage CLI. While `swc` has slightly slower transpilation times, its a library backed by a larger community, and allows us to take advantage of [React Refresh](https://www.npmjs.com/package/react-refresh) out of the box. Theres a few things that could possibly break installations of Backstage and compilation, you can read more about it in the [changelog](https://github.com/backstage/backstage/blob/515aadf8840591860e4bbdcc7d99cef8f9d7ac3c/docs/releases/v1.6.0-changelog.md#patch-changes-1)
### React Router Stable Compatibility
Backstage has for a long time been using React Router version `6.0.0-beta.0`. We adopted this unstable version because v6 had some new features that fit really well with Backstage, particularly relative routing. Because we jumped on this early and unstable version, we knew that we would at some point need a breaking migration to the stable version of React Router v6, which is the point we're at now!
The migration is controlled by each app, meaning this release will not force you to migrate straight away, you can do so at your own pace. Check out the [migration guide](https://backstage.io/docs/tutorials/react-router-stable-migration) for all you need to know!
### Yarn 3 Support
It is now possible to migrate Backstage projects to use Yarn 3. See the [migration guide](https://backstage.io/docs/tutorials/yarn-migration) for more information. Migrating to Yarn 3 is optional, and Backstage projects created with `@backstage/create-app` will still use classic Yarn by default.
### New plugin: `@backstage/plugin-user-settings-backend`
The `user-settings` plugin now has an associated backend. This allows for the persistence of settings in your database, essentially in the form of a basic per-user key-value JSON store.
As this backend was added, `user-settings` also gained a `UserSettingsStore` class that implements the `storageApiRef` Utility API. If you install the backend as well as this frontend API, your starred entities and other storage-API-based features will no longer just be persisted in your browsers local storage, but centrally so that all your devices can leverage them.
Contributed by [@dschwank](https://github.com/dschwank) in [#13570](https://github.com/backstage/backstage/pull/13570)
### New plugin: `@backstage/plugin-playlist`
This plugin can be used to create custom collections of Entities that can be shared throughout Backstage or for private usage.
Contributed by [@kuangp](https://github.com/kuangp) in [#12870](https://github.com/backstage/backstage/pull/12870)
## Security Fixes
Be sure to upgrade to the latest version of `@backstage/plugin-scaffolder-backend`, as it contains an explicit bump of a transitive dependency where a vulnerability was discovered. If you subscribe to CVE notifications you will already have received this update.
